Grub2 con LVM - "error: cannot find a device for / (is /dev mounted?)."
Tengo un problemilla con grub2 en Squeeze. Tras una
actualización, cada vez que se ejecuta "update-grub" o "update-grub2"
me da un mensaje tipo:
/usr/sbin/grub-probe: error: cannot find a device for / (is /dev
mounted?).
Parece que es un problema nuevo, introducido a partir del
kernel 2.6.32-5, pero no encuentro una solución razonable.
Por el camino y las pruebas, he perdido el parámetro "root="
del grub, teniéndolo que incluir este a mano en cada reinicio. He
intentado recuperarlo añadiendolo al '/etc/default/grub'
GRUB_CMDLINE_LINUX="rootfstype=ext4 root=/dev/mapper/rootvg/root"
pero como 'update-grub' no funciona, esto tampoco, aunque creo
que añadir un segundo parámetro "root=" tampoco es buena idea
Como solución temporal he añadido esta ruta "a mano" en el
'/boot/grub/grub.cfg', pero cada actualización tendré que repetir esto.
Saludos --- Angel
Reply to: